7 Example Sentences Showcasing the Meaning of 'Steamed'

After waiting for hours at the airport, the passengers became steamed when their flight was delayed without any explanation.

The politician appeared steamed during the heated debate when his opponent made false accusations against him.

The IT specialist was steamed as he worked tirelessly to fix the network issues caused by a sudden power outage.

Despite her calm exterior, Sarah was internally steamed about the criticism.

The employee was steamed when her promotion was overlooked.

The author was steamed when the publisher made significant edits without consultation.

The scientist was steamed when her groundbreaking research was dismissed without consideration.
